Computed tomography-based radiomics analysis of abscess and cellulitis in odontogenic infections
Hiroshi Yamamoto1, Hirotaka Muraoka2, Erika Iwai1
1Department of Oral Surgery, Nihon University School of Dentistry at Matsudo 2-870-1 Sakaecho-Nishi, Matsudo, Chiba 271-8587, Japan.
Purpose:
This study aimed to compare computed tomography (CT) radiomic features of abscesses and cellulitis associated with odontogenic infections in the head and neck region.
Materials And Methods:
Fifty-eight patients who presented with pain and swelling due to odontogenic infections and underwent head and neck CT between July 2020 and August 2024 were retrospectively analyzed. A final diagnosis of abscess or cellulitis was established based on comprehensive clinical, radiological, and surgical findings. Using MaZda version 4.6.2.0, 279 texture features were extracted from three manually placed circular regions of interest positioned within the anterior, central, and posterior portions of the largest axial cross-section of each lesion. Statistical comparisons were performed for all extracted texture features using the Mann-Whitney U test with Bonferroni correction for multiple comparisons. Fisher's coefficient was subsequently used to rank the discriminatory ability of the significant features, and the 10 highest-ranked features were evaluated using receiver operating characteristic (ROC) analysis.
Results:
All extracted texture features remained significantly different after Bonferroni correction. Histogram-derived features demonstrated marked differences in the gray-level distribution within the representative circular regions of interest between the two groups. Gray-level co-occurrence matrix correlation values were consistently higher in abscesses than in cellulitis. ROC analysis of the 10 highest-ranked texture features demonstrated excellent discriminatory ability, with AUC values ranging from 0.95 to 0.99.
Conclusions:
CT texture analysis identified objective imaging features that may help differentiate abscesses from cellulitis in odontogenic infections. However, further validation is required before clinical application.
